I went here with my partner and found it to be very average, gluten free or not. I’m celiac and my partner is not, and neither of us found the food to be that great. I ordered the 4 cheese ravioli and he ordered the truffle noir gnocchi - both were average, not bad not good just in the middle. The service was alright, not very friendly but also not overtly rude or anything. I found it strange that after telling the waitress I have celiac/gluten allergy she would put gluten bread at the table. Made me question the safety. All in all I would not recommend to a fellow no gluten person. Tasca is way better taste wise and safety wise and when I’m Paris and wanting Italian I will probably only go there as I felt su misura really wasn’t worth it.
